Just a note to tell you that I will be performing in “Undercover Showtunes,” the second night of NYMF’s highly-anticipated Spring benefit concert series to raise funds for the 2007 NYMF Festival. The evening will feature an extraordinary and eclectic group of Broadway, TV and film performers bringing out the theatrical side of the music world’s most beloved rock and pop songs, an approach that met with great acclaim in their kickoff concert of songs by singer/songwriter Ben Folds.
Also peforming will be: Gloria Reuben, Alison Fraser, Christian Campbell, Mano Felciano, Michael Winther, Stephinie D'Abruzzo, Peter Friedman, MMIriam Shor, Ann Morrison, Mary Faber and Natascia Diaz.
Undercover Showtunes will take place on Monday, June 18 at 7 PM at the Zipper Theater in New York. They are located at 336 W. 37th St. between 8th and 9th Aves.
Featured songwriters include Paul McCartney & John Lennon, Joni Mitchell, Rufus Wainwright, Marc Cohn, David Bowie, Stephin Merritt, Fiona Apple, Stevie Wonder, Neil Young, Elton John, Harry Nilsson, The Decemberists, Bjork and many more. Hope to see you there!

It was the best of times. It was the worst of times.

I've been thinking a lot lately about my start on Broadway. I think it's because of how much I loved the group, how proud I am of all of them and how in love I am with them still. This is the cast of Jesus Christ Superstar in 2000 at the Ford Center for the Performing Arts (now the Hilton Center). We were the second show to occupy that theatre. Ragtime was the first (and what an honor to follow that show).
But if you look closely, you'll see a kind of "Who's Who of People I Love".
You probably can't find me. I'm in the back sandwiched between two of my favorite people. I'm 3rd from the right in the back row (gees, I feel like i'm looking at an elementary school photo) between Manoel Felciano (Tony nominee this year for Sweeney Todd) and Jason Pebworth (the greatest Judas I've ever seen and a dear friend) Jason struggled for years with his band Halogen. Just recently they changed their name to Orson and are a huge hit overseas! Yay!
To Mano's left, Tony Vincent, then Max VonEssen (Dance of the Vampires), Bonnie Panson, Patrick Vacariello, Ira Mont (Equity Vice-President). Let's see...down front and center, Deidre Goodwin (Chorus Line, Chicago The Movie...the sweetest woman alive). Down the row to her left you'll see Christian Borle (Spamalot) and Lisa Brescia (closed Aida as Amneris). Others: Shayna Steele, Michael Seelbach. I could talk about them all forever. I loved this time and I love that it brought me to where I am now.
